Mia Tindall Playfully Tries to Distract Prince George During Sandringham Christmas Walk

Mia Tindallpoked some fun at her cousinPrince Georgeon Christmas!

In a cheeky momentcaught on camera(starting at 3:42 in the clip below) during the royal family’swalk from churchat Sandringham on Sunday, 8-year-old Mia playfully poked George, 9, in the back from behind as she walked past him. Prince George was greeting well-wishers with his parentsPrince WilliamandKate Middletonand siblingsPrincess Charlotte, 7, andPrince Louis, 4, when Mia attempted to distract him. Already a poised royal, George didn’t react when his second cousin tried to surprise him.

Mia is the eldest daughter ofQueen Elizabeth’s granddaughterZara Tindall, making her second cousins with George, Charlotte and Louis. Zara and her husbandMike Tindalloften bring Mia and their 4-year-old daughter Lena to royal family events (which son Lucas, 1, is still likely deemed too young to attend). In June, Mia and Lena sat behind their second cousins during Queen Elizabeth’sPlatinum Jubilee Pageant, where Mia similarly made silly faces and chatted with her family — much like Prince Louis’adorable antics!

Later, Mike (who sat next to his daughters and behind the Wales children at the pageant) opened up about what it was like to have a front-row seat to Louis' now-viral mischief.
